Abstract
This article found out that inappropriate mounting gap between the key phase sensor and corresponding key phase marker was the main cause of excessive turbine eccentricity which occurred in TQNPC, put forward an improved mounting method of key phase sensor which not only avoids the fault recurring, but also can be used as work reference to similar rotary mechanism.
